Tenants in at Park 2000

THE Park 2000 business park has welcomed two new tenants to South leeds.

Pre-stressed concrete firm CCL and Harrison Spinks, a bed manufacturer, have both taken units at the business park off Dewsbury Road.

CCL has invested in a 35,000 sq ft warehouse while Harrison Spinks has added a 23,000 sq ft unit to its property holdings in the area.

Iain McPhail, associate at GVA, said: “We are pleased that we could facilitate the expansion of these two Leeds-based companies who have worked closely together to mutually benefit from upgraded premises.

“It was by no means a simple deal and it is satisfying to see local firms performing so well in what are still challenging times.”

Adam Peacock, industrial and logistics agent at Lambert Smith Hampton, which acted for the vendor, said: “The two deals represent a huge boost for Leeds, and Park 2000 in particular.

“It is positive to see that some companies are pressing ahead with expansion plans in the face of adverse market conditions, and goes to show that there is still an appetite for well located, modern, high quality industrial buildings within the Leeds area.”
